New York Rescuers Break the Ice to Save Moose From a Frozen Lake

18 January 2025 at 18:00
The bull moose had fallen into a lake in the Adirondacks and been in the frigid waters for about two hours before rescuers arrived and used a chain saw to free it.

When They Hear Plants Cry, Moths Make a Decision

6 December 2024 at 05:02
A new study suggests that the insects rely on the sounds made by distressed vegetation to guide important reproductive choices.
